William Bernard Herlands
1905–1969 · New York, NY
Judicial Service
| Court | Title | Appointed By | Commissioned | Termination |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| U.S. District Court for the Southern District of New York | Judge | Dwight D. Eisenhower (Republican) | Jun 27, 1956 | Death, Aug 28, 1969 |
Education
- City College of New York, B.S., 1925
- Columbia Law School, LL.B., 1928
Professional Career
Private practice, New York City, 1928-1931, 1940-1954; Assistant U.S. attorney, Southern District of New York, 1931-1934; Assistant corporate counsel, New York City, 1934-1935; Assistant to the special prosecutor, New York County, New York, 1935-1937; Commissioner of investigation, New York City, 1938-1944; Judge, New York Court of Domestic Relations, 1940; Special assistant attorney general, State of New York, 1944-1945; Special prosecutor, Richmond County, New York, 1951-1954; Member, New York State Board of Mediation, 1950-1954; Special counsel, New York State Tax Commission, 1953-1954; Commissioner of investigation, State of New York, 1954-1955
